UART Serial Interfaces – UART0 and UART1
Mode B
Mode B is an integrated full-duplex asynchronous serial communication interface. The 8 bits
of data are received via the RXD1 pin while the TXD1 pin provides the data transmit for this
communication. The data will then be transferred to the Transmit Shift Register from where it
will be shifted out onto the TXD1 pin by the UART1 Baud rate generator. The internal Baud rate
generator is enabled/disabled by the BD1 bit of the SBRCON register. The S1RELL/S1RELH
registers must be used to setup the Baud rate generator.
Data transmission is started by writing data to the S1BUF register. The TXD1 pin outputs data.
The first bit transmitted is a start bit, always “0”, then 8 bits of data, after which a stop bit, always “1”,
is transmitted.
Data to be received by the UART1 is accepted on the external RXD1 pin. When reception starts,
UART1 synchronises with the falling edge detected by the RXD1 pin. Input data is available after
one byte of data is complete in the S1BUF register and the value of the STOP bit is available as the
RB81 flag in the S1CON register. During the reception process, the S1BUF data and the RB81 bit
will remain unchanged until the process is complete.
